Output d620828e1810c9d5b784ef89d4dbd7b69baf0d95340ddf468a2537d2d003c54b:7

value
245034083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0354f3ec6639fc46abae8a4867378c4c8d993853 OP_EQUAL
address
M8Cn2dadfWyCotJEu4aXz9ftWbiv8yE41n
transaction
d620828e1810c9d5b784ef89d4dbd7b69baf0d95340ddf468a2537d2d003c54b
spent
true